Without question, the card is the most popular collectible. For decades, football and baseball cards plus every other type of card you can think of, has been reproduced and distributed. By taking a good look around, you might discover hidden treasures from your own (or a relative’s) childhood.
This doesn’t require a financial investment and is an excellent way to start your card collection. That said, cards are not the only highly sought after sports collectibles. Other items like jerseys, balls, helmets, or pictures can all be considered collectibles. If you have a ball you caught at a baseball game, it is a collectible.

First of all, a cleaning kit needs to be purchased which will ensure that your memorabilia are maintained in the best possible condition. The next step is to come up with ways to display your collectibles. This could be a binder for your baseball cards, or some sort of display case to keep everything behind glass.
No matter which sports collectibles you purchase, they need to be kept away from possible hazards. Your collectibles are likely to be of value later if you make the effort to preserve them properly.
Collectibles are not restricted to a particular time period or sport. Some people love to accumulate modern collectibles, including football games and NASCAR models, while others opt for older baseball cards. There are a wide range of sports collectibles for your favorite player or racer, everything from diecast race models to replica helmets. Or, if you are just a fan of the sport in general, you can purchase more generic collectibles that don’t support anyone in specific.
